Q: How do I install the Beloved Font on my computer?

To install the Beloved Font, simply extract the font files from the zip archive and copy them to your computer’s font folder (usually located at C:\Windows\Fonts on Windows or ~/Library/Fonts on macOS). Alternatively, you can use a font manager to install and manage your fonts.
